hello,
I am from mumbai and intend to visit leh. I want to do both the safaries i.e. srinagar-leh and manali-leh as i have heard that both r awesome in their own ways. I want to know that which direction should i choose and why? 1. Fly from mumbai to srinagar. By road to leh and then by road to manali and then delhi. From delhi fly back to mumbai 2. Fly to delhi. By road to manali -leh - srinagar. Then fly back to mumbai from srinagar Which is the best month to do this tour? |

Hi Poonam.
The better way to do it is Srinagar-Leh-Manali. You do not hit very high altitude on the Srinagar-Leh route and thus your acclimatization is gradual and safer. And if you are interested in seeing Pahalgam, Gulmarg and Sonamarg (en route to Leh), you could plan for a night at each of these places. Apart from the beauty that you'll enjoy, you will get well acclimatized while being 'on-the-job'! Last edited by anupmathur; 01-05-08 at 04:27 PM. |

Anup sir is right; acclimatization would be a big issue on the Manali - Leh highway.
In fact the only reason I recommend those traveling on motorcycles and cars to go through Manali first is because of the fact that even if vehicle is in bad condition after many days of abuse, they can still do Leh - Srinagar with ease. Best time would be July to mid September, however if you wish to see lots of snow, then May, June, September and October are the month to go. |

If you are starting from Delhi, it takes two days to reach Srinagar by road, while it takes one to reach Manali. This is how majority of the travelers who are starting from Delhi, save one day.
Add to this, until a few years back, Zoji - Kargil highway was at times under Pakistani shelling. In fact one can still read warning sign boards on the Kargil – Zoji La stretch, warning them that they are under enemy observation. ![]() Also quite a few people do Manali - Leh journey in one day in what is known as the canon ball run, I don’t think this is done on Srinagar - Leh stretch. Also like I earlier said, Manali - Leh is more scenic and adventures than Srinagar - Leh. It is relatively safe, as for crackers they bust in Delhi and Mumbai as well, so no real big issue unless there is a specific threat to tourists or if Pakistani start shelling on the highway again. |
